About this work

This looks like a blueprint sketch taped to a page. You can see walls, beams, and staircases drawn in pencil and ink. A handwritten note below explains how to adjust the design. The artist cut and pasted paper to make parts of the drawing. The lines are rough but show careful thought. Look up cross-hatching next to see how artists use lines to create depth.
